The organic form has served as a catalyst of inspiration for designers for centuries. Biomimicry, the science of emulating nature's solutions, takes this notion to a new realm. By studying the anthropometrical systems, designers can discover innovative methods for products. Anthropometric design, which concentrates in the measurements of the human body, possesses an essential role in manufacturing products that are not only functional but also user-friendly.

  • Illustrations of biomimicry in design span from the streamlined design of high-speed trains, inspired by bird wings, to the adaptable structures of buildings, imitating the connected nature of bone.
  • Moreover, anthropometric design principles are indispensable in developing furniture, clothing, and other items that accommodate the user's proportions.

Ultimately, by adopting the wisdom of both biomimicry and anthropometric design, designers can develop products that are not only practical but also harmonious with the human experience.
